This partnership marks a significant milestone for Golden Arrow and underscores their commitment to providing cutting-edge marine solutions to customers across the UK.
As the newly appointed Humphree centre, Golden Arrow Marine will offer a comprehensive range of interceptor and stabilisation products, along with expert servicing and refit solutions.
Paul Dean, Head of Engineering at Golden Arrow Marine, said: ‘We are delighted to solidify our partnership with Humphree and become a centre for interceptor and stabilisation solutions in the UK. This collaboration enables us to enhance our offerings and better serve the evolving needs of our leisure yacht customers, ensuring they have access to the latest innovations in marine stabilisation technology and maximising their enjoyment and comfort at sea in all UK boating conditions.’
In addition to their existing product line-up, Golden Arrow will also be involved in Humphree’s newest product, the Lightning System, an automatic trim and stabilisation system suitable for boats of 20–45 ft.
